VILLAGE OF MARATHON CITY Veterans Park Ball Complex Marathon City, Wisconsin Sealed bids for the construction of the following: Project No. 200326 Veteran's Park Ball Complex - to include: the construction of a new athletic complex. Project elements include but are not limited to new softball/baseball fields, parking lot, basketball courts, press box/restroom/concession building, pavilion, maintenance/storage building, challenge course/playground, multi-use trail, pedestrian underpass, sanitary sewer, water main construction, restoration of the work area, and other miscellaneous items in conformance with the contract documents.
